#b0c1da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b0c1da is composed of 69% red, 75.7% green and 85.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 19.3% cyan, 11.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 14.5% black. It has a hue angle of 215.7 degrees, a saturation of 36.2% and a lightness of 77.3%. #b0c1da color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6183b5. Closest websafe color is: #99cccc.

#b0c1da color description : Light grayish blue.

#b0c1da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b0c1da has RGB values of R:176, G:193, B:218 and CMYK values of C:0.19, M:0.11, Y:0,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 11583962.

Shades and Tints of #b0c1da

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f3f5f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b0c1da

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c2c4c8 is the less saturated color, while #8cbafe is the most saturated one.
